#1ff98a h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#1ff98a is composed of 12.2% red, 97.6% green and 54.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 44.6%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 149.4 degrees, a saturation of 94.8% and a lightness of 54.9%. #1ff98a color hex could be obtained by blending #3effff with #00f315. Closest websafe color is: #33ff99.

● #1ff98a color description : Vivid cyan - lime green.
The hexadecimal color #1ff98a has RGB values of R:31, G:249, B:138 and CMYK values of C:0.88, M:0, Y:0.45,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 2095498.
